Technical Field

The invention belongs to the technical field of medical treatment, and particularly relates to a telescopic tumor clamping device.

background

The tumor tissue is composed of parenchyma and stroma, and the tumor parenchyma is tumor cells, is a main component of the tumor and has tissue source specificity. It determines the biological characteristics of the tumor and the specificity of each tumor. The tissue origin of various tumors is generally identified according to the parenchymal morphology of the tumor, classification, naming and histological diagnosis of the tumor are performed, and the benign and malignant degree of the tumor and the malignant degree of the tumor are determined according to the differentiation maturity degree and the size of the heterogeneity.

surgical treatment of tumors is one of the most widely and effectively applied clinical treatments, and the therapeutic effect thereof is clinically recognized. When operation treatment tumour, need use the tumour to press from both sides the device and separate tumour tissue, but when clinical application, the current tumour is pressed from both sides and is got separator and can't carry out telescopic length adjustment according to the position of tumour, the implementation of the tumour operation of being not convenient for, operability and suitability are poor.

Application publication number is CN109124728A, and the patent name is "device is got to telescopic tumour clamp", including first arm lock, second arm lock and third arm lock, the right side fixedly connected with push rod at second arm lock top, logical groove that uses with the push rod cooperation is seted up at the top of first arm lock, and the outside that leads to the groove is provided with the spacing groove, the equal fixedly connected with bracing piece in both sides of second arm lock bottom, the first slider of bottom fixedly connected with of bracing piece. According to the invention, through the matched use of the first clamping arm, the second clamping arm, the first sliding chute, the first sliding block, the supporting rod, the push rod, the compression spring, the second sliding chute, the second sliding block, the sliding rod, the third clamping arm, the telescopic rod, the through groove and the limiting groove, although the length can be adjusted, when the lengths of the two first clamping arms are adjusted, the upper clamping block and the lower clamping block on the first clamping arm are difficult to adjust to corresponding matching positions, the position adjustment is difficult, and when the length of the first clamping arm is larger, the clamping is difficult to accurately clamp.

Therefore, it is necessary to provide a telescopic tumor clamping device.

Compared with the prior art, the invention has the following beneficial effects:

The telescopic mechanism adopts a shear type telescopic mechanism, the length adjustment of the clamping device can be realized, the planar link mechanism is adopted to rotate the movable cutter to complete the clamping operation, the relative positions of the fixed cutter and the movable cutter are not changed after the length adjustment, the matching positions of the fixed cutter and the movable cutter do not need to be repeatedly adjusted, the whole structure is simple, the length adjustment is convenient and labor-saving, the positioning is reliable, the clamping operation is convenient and labor-saving, and the practicability is high.
